Before we start our studies, note that sculptors can use a lot of different raw materials, but Takanon-sensei uses ‘polyester putty’. 

To put it in a nutshell, polyester putty is the kind of putty you carve down into the shape you want.

Sensei! Teach us about some of your tools!

002

(1) Hardening Spray: Used to speed up the drying of glue.
(2) Instant Glue: Added to putty to make it harden faster.
(3) Sandpaper: Used for finishing touches and making smooth surfaces.
(4) Nippers: Used to cut things like Nendoroid joints and brass wires.
(5) Chisel Set: Used to carve out bits of putty.
(6) Design Knife: This is where the sculpting really begins!
(7) Craft Knife: Miscellaneous tasks.
(8) Pin Vice: Used to dig out holes. Size is changed based on diameter.
(9) Needle: Used along with the pin vice.

(10) Putty Stand: The polyester putty is made on this stand.
(11) Polyester Putty: White: Main Putty; Yellow: Hardening Agent.
(12) Tooth Brush: An old toothbrush. Cleans up carvings.
(13) Clutch Pencil: Used to mark where joints and eyes will be placed.
(14) Tweezers: Reach places when they can’t be reached by hand.
(15) Ruler: Simply used to make sure the sizes match up.
(16) Vernier Scale: Used to measure curved parts

(10) Putty Stand

This is actually called something completely different at Max Factory – it seems the name differs between companies! ^^

This stand is used to mix the white and yellow parts of the polyester putty together using something like a toothpick.

This creates the raw materials for sculpting!

Once mixed the putty will slowly harden, so it goes in a cycle of a process – mix, mold, harden and sculpt. Normally the white and yellow parts are mixed at a 5:1 ratio, but sometimes more of the hardening agent is added to make it harden faster!

Let’s take a look at how exactly it is used!

First the area you want the hole is marked by the clutch pencil (13), then the needle (9) is used to make a little dent on the putty!

007

A pin vice (8) is then used on the dented area to make a hole!

Apparently by just using the pin vice without a dent, it’s very easy to slip and not make a straight hole! 

Bascially it’s just a way to make sure that it works out smoothly!

010

(3) Sandpaper!

There are apparently a lot of different types of sandpaper.

To divide them into three broad types, there would be paper, cloth and sponge types.

The paper type is used for straight lines, while the cloth and sponge types are much softer and are used for curved surfaces. Right here Takanon is making use of the paper type.

By the way, in the first picture of the tools with numbers there was a little pink thing with a handle – this is also a type of file like the sandpaper, and is called a ‘Tiler’. The opposite side of the handle has a rough surface that can be replaced by double-sided tape when it wears away.

009

(16) Vernier Scale!

This is to calculate things like whether or not the thickness of the arms is the same on both sides. Measuring curved surfaces with a straight ruler is pretty much impossible, so that’s when the Vernier scale comes into play! You simply place the object to be measured between the two parts and you get the exact size.

The damage that has occurred during the March 11 quake in the Touhoku region is astounding, and in order to get over the destruction caused there is a lot that needs to be done, and lots of support that needs to be given. Good Smile Company has formed a support group named ‘Cheerful Japan’ which will strive to support the relief efforts for as long as possible. For at least 1 year we be releasing charity products among other efforts to raise donation money for the cause. To everyone who supports the Cheerful Japan movement – thank you, and know that your money is going where it is needed!

To support the relief efforts up North, we will be announcing a charity product every month on the 11th, starting with this month and continuing for a year!
